Do trends in kitchen and bath renovations really shift so radically one year to the next? The changes may seem so small year to year, but look back five to ten years and you really can tell the difference. Renovating that often really isn’t practical – but seeing the small changes and the newest products can help you update in minor ways – or decide you need a whole new kitchen!

Freshome is a great resource for staying in touch with what’s happening throughout the industry. Their latest article, at http://bit.ly/1fImy0E has some great ideas.

“The kitchen industry is seeing a shift away from the almighty all white kitchen trend which has swept the industry over the past couple of years and is now seeing a move towards natural materials, brass accessories, monochrome minimalism and patterned splash backs. Here, we at Freshome will predict what we believe will be the strongest kitchen trends in 2014…”
